A member asked:

Can i get covid 19 from street cat which was 1 meter away ?

No: There have reports of CATS in China that have tested positive for COVID 19. However, very few pets in the US have tested positive. I know of no verified cases where a pet transmitted COVID 19 to an owner, person. The risk would not likely be from a cat one meter away - if would be if the cat was licking the mouth/ face of someone or their contaminated fur was petted. No cases to date.
